Bonus: 20 Years at SLE
from ScotLand Matters: The Scottish Land and Estates Podcast · host Scottish Land and Estates
This year, SLE's Chief Executive Sarah-Jane Laing celebrates her 20th year at the organisation. To mark the occasion, the ScotLand Matters Podcast is reflecting on her time here, with Donald Greig - our Membership Communications Manager - in conversation with SJ alongside friends, members and colleagues.We were pleased to be joined by Robert Scott-Dempster, head of Land and Rural Business at Gillespie MacAndrew and chair of SLE's Legal and Tax Group; and David Johnston, former SLE Chairman and owner of Annandale Estate in Dumfriesshire .In a wide ranging discussion we look back at the highs and lows of the last 20 years at SLE, whilst also taking a moment to look ahead at what's coming down the track for rural Scotland in the future.
